Understanding Bolt-On Modifications

Bolt-on modifications refer to performance upgrades that can be installed without extensive modifications to the vehicle’s structure. These upgrades typically include components that can be easily attached to the engine or exhaust system. The primary goal is to enhance performance while maintaining reliability.

Turbo Upgrades

One of the most effective ways to increase horsepower in a VW GTI is through turbo upgrades. The stock turbocharger can limit performance, and upgrading to a larger or more efficient unit can provide significant gains.

Choosing the Right Turbo

When selecting a turbo upgrade, consider the following options:

  • K04 Turbo: A popular choice for those seeking a balance between performance and reliability.
  • GTX Turbo: Offers higher efficiency and potential for greater power, suitable for serious enthusiasts.
  • Hybrid Turbo: Combines features of both stock and performance turbos, providing a unique blend of power and drivability.

Installation Considerations

Installing a new turbo requires careful consideration of supporting modifications. Upgrades such as intercoolers, exhaust systems, and intake systems are essential to maximize the benefits of the new turbo. Ensure all components are compatible with your chosen turbo for optimal performance.

ECU Remapping

After upgrading the turbo, the next critical step is ECU remapping. This process involves reprogramming the vehicle’s engine control unit to optimize performance parameters, ensuring that the new turbo operates efficiently.

Benefits of ECU Remapping

ECU remapping provides several advantages, including:

  • Increased Power: Tailoring the fuel and ignition maps can significantly boost horsepower and torque.
  • Improved Throttle Response: A remapped ECU can enhance engine responsiveness, making the vehicle feel more agile.
  • Better Fuel Efficiency: Optimizing the fuel mixture can lead to improved fuel economy, especially during normal driving conditions.

Choosing a Tuner

Selecting a reputable tuner is crucial for successful ECU remapping. Look for tuners with experience in VW performance tuning and positive reviews from other GTI owners. A good tuner will ensure that the remap is tailored to your specific modifications and driving style.

Supporting Modifications

To achieve optimal performance with your turbo upgrade and ECU remap, consider additional supporting modifications.

Exhaust System Upgrades

A high-flow exhaust system can reduce back pressure and improve exhaust flow, enhancing turbo performance. Consider options such as:

  • Cat-Back Exhaust: Replaces the exhaust system from the catalytic converter back, improving flow and sound.
  • Downpipe: Upgrading the downpipe can reduce restrictions and improve turbo spool time.

Intake System Upgrades

An upgraded intake system can increase airflow to the engine, helping to maximize the benefits of your turbo upgrade. Options include:

  • Cold Air Intake: Provides cooler, denser air to the engine, improving combustion efficiency.
  • High-Performance Air Filter: Improves airflow while filtering out contaminants more effectively than stock filters.
